HBO’s new Harry Potter TV series started filming on the 14th of this month, 14 years after the last Harry Potter movie,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ows: Part 2, which released on July 15, 2011. The new series is set to follow the same footsteps as the movies with each season adapting one book. Dominic McLaughlin (Harry Potter), Arabella Stanton (Hermione Granger), and Alastair Stout (Ron Weasley) will play the iconic roles made famous by Daniel Radcliffe, Emma Watson and Rupert Grint. Apart from the main trio, HBO has announced many more of the other cast who will play regular and recurring roles in the series
Harry Potter Week 1
The first week saw filming in Leavesden Studios, and a few locations around London. Filming on the first day was at Leavesden Studios, where the the team has built huge sets to replicate various locations from the books. Group scenes that involved multiple extras were filmed there.

Location 2: Jenny’s Restaurant in Hayes
Harry Potter tv series filmed at Jenny’s Restaurant in Hayes on 15 July.

Although little is known about the cast or the scene filmed at the restaurant, the production unit took over the restaurant for almost a week to set up for the scene. Rain machines were used outside the restaurant to simulate rain and appear as if it had been raining when the scene was filmed.
It could be the scene in the book when Hagrid and Harry, after a busy day of shopping at Diagon Alley, return to London and sit down at a restaurant in Paddington Station to grab hamburgers, but we aren’t sure.
Location 3: The London Zoo
The Reptile enclosure at the London Zoo was used in the Harry Potter movies, so it was no surprise when news of filming at the zoo reached the fandom. The series filmed at the zoo on July 16 at the penguin section and the reptile sections.
Fortunately for the fandom, the news reached the paparazzi too, and we got the first unofficial pictures of Harry, the Dursleys, and Piers Polkiss (via The Sun and Daily Mail)
It is possible that a scene where the Dursleys bought ice-creams was also filmed because an ice-cream van was part of the filming and we see the Dursleys having ice cream in the leaked photos
Location 4: Perryn Road, Acton
On July 18, old 90’s model cars were seen being transported to a residential neighborhood in Acton for the milkman scene (via u/eflor_elliven)
Harry Potter Week 2
Location 5: Encampment Station
Nick Frost’s double and Dominic McLauglin were seen filming at Embankment Station on July 21. The scene is probably from the scene when Hagrid takes Harry to Diagon Alley to buy his school supplies.

Location 6?: Old Magistrate’s Court, Watford
The old Magistrate’s Court is a popular filming location in Watford where series like Adolescence have been filmed. Warner Bros. vans and crew were seen there on July 21, the same day when filming also took place at the Embankment Station. We could not spot any signs or evidence at the Magistrate’s court that could confirm that it was the filming of Harry Potter.
There are two other WB productions currently filming in London: House of the Dragon and Ghostwriter. The former is a medieval fantasy, and the latter is rumored to be science fiction; hence, the location seems more likely to be the Harry Potter series. The magistrate’s court could be the setting for the Ministry of Magic.
Location 7: JFK school, Hemel Hempstead
The series was filmed at Hemel Hempstead School on 24 July. It is rumored to be the setting for the Muggle school Harry attended when he lived with the Dursleys.

To facilitate schooling for the actors who have been cast, WB is constructing a temporary school that can house up to 600 pupils. Cast members are expected to attend classes alongside their filming duties, with around 150 children expected to attend daily lessons, and space for up to quadruple at peak periods. It will operate on weekdays between 5:30 am and 8:30 pm so young actors can fit in their actual studies between night shoots, reshoots, and location filming.
Harry Potter series will film until May 2026 and is eyeing a 2027 release. Season 2 will begin filming back-to-back after Season 1 after a short break. Stay tuned to Redanian Intelligence for more news.
